How long do cooked hash browns last?

Cooked hash browns will last in the refrigerator for up to 5 days before they start growing mold and go bad.

After 5 days in the refrigerator the cooked hash browns will likely be growing mold and should be thrown out if they do have mold on them or have grown other bacteria as well.

You can keep the cooked hash browns longer than 5 days if you freeze them instead and then the frozen cooked hash browns will last for 6 months to a year.

Although after a month the cooked hash browns will start to go stale and not be as fresh tasting but they will still be good to eat.

So if you don't plan to eat the cooked hash browns within 5 days of refrigerating them then you should really freeze them to keep them from growing mold and going bad.
